Even when another driver “looks at fault,” rideshare claims can involve multiple potential coverage sources—depending on the timing of the trip and whether the driver was logged in, en route, or actively transporting a passenger.
In Avon and throughout Ohio, claims are often delayed when the parties argue about:
- Whether the trip was active in the app at the moment of impact
- Who is responsible for the collision versus who is responsible for injuries
- What your medical records show about causation and symptom timing
Because Ohio insurance practices can be aggressive about recorded statements and early narratives, it’s important to treat the first days after your crash as an evidence-building window—not a time to “smooth things over” with an adjuster.
